History & Origin

Nathanaelle is a French feminine form of Nathanael/Nathaniel, from the Hebrew Netan'el, 'God has given.' It reads elegant and rare — uncommon in the U.S. (said 'nuh-than-uh-EL').

It appears only rarely in the U.S. Rare, elegant, and faith-rooted.
